The Jefferson City Jays got the start they wanted, just not the ending.
"The way we played at the beginning of the game was what we were looking for," Jays coach Eddie Horn said after Wednesday's 3-1 loss to the Rockhurst Hawklets at the 179 Soccer Park. "But after that, things went downhill."
Wednesday's junior varsity game ended scoreless. The Jays end the JV season at 9-6-4.
